Jim's Outfitters, Inc., makes custom fancy shirts for cowboys. The shirts could be flawed in various ways, including flaws in the weave or color of the fabric, loose buttons or decorations, wrong dimensions, and unevenstitches. Jim randomly examined 10 shirts, with the fol-lowing results: Shirt Defects 18 20 37 412 55 610 72 84 96 10 6 a. Assuming that 10 observations are adequate for these purposes, determine the three-sigma control limits for defects per shirt. b. Suppose that the next shirt has 13 flaws. What can you say about the process now?
